Salmon Burgers with Peach Salsa

A great new way to use those delicious fresh peaches!

2 Large peaches or 1 cup frozen peaches, diced

1 Medium Jalapeno pepper, cored, seeded and finely chopped (do not touch seeds with bare hands)

1 tsp Fresh lemon juice

1 1/2 tsp sugar

1/8 tsp Salt

2 T Fresh cilantro, chopped

14  3/4 oz Canned red salmon, drained, broken into small cubes

3 Green onions, finely chopped

2 1/2 tsp Lemon zest

1 Egg, beaten

1/4 tsp Black pepper

3 1/2 T Corn flake crumbs

 To prepare salsa, combine peaches, jalapeno and lemon juice in a medium bowl.  Add sugar and mix well.  Stir in salt and cilantro and toss gently to mix; set aside.  Preheat broiler or grill.  Spray broiler pan or grill with non-stick spray.  To prepare burgers, combine salmon, onions, lemon zest, egg, black pepper and corn flake crumbs in a  medium bowl; mix well.  Shape salmon mixture into four 1-inch thick patties.  Broil or grill for 3-5 minutes.  Flip burgers and cook about 3 minutes more, until golden brown on both sides.  Serve salmon burgers with peach salsa on the side.

Serves 4.  Per serving includes about 1/2 c salsa:  213 calories, 8 g fat, 2 g saturated fat, 111 mg cholesterol, 719 mg sodium, 12 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 23 g protein
